## Elder-Well — franchise facts

### What is the total initial investment required to open a Elder-Well franchise?

Total investment ranges from $51,800 to $149,200 depending on territory size, service offerings, and operational scope. This includes the franchise fee, equipment, initial marketing, working capital, and technology setup to launch your senior care operation.

### What is the initial franchise fee for Elder-Well, and what does it cover?

The franchise fee is $42,500, with eligible veterans and affiliates receiving discounts. This one-time fee provides access to systems, training, branding, and initial operational support to establish your franchise.

### What ongoing fees, royalties, or required contributions do Elder-Well franchisees pay?

Ongoing fees consist of an 8% hybrid royalty on revenue and a 1% advertising fund contribution, plus $350 monthly technology fees. These recurring costs support continued training, system updates, marketing resources, and technology platform access.

### What financial requirements must candidates meet to qualify for a Elder-Well franchise?

Franchisees should have liquid capital of $30,000 to $75,000 and demonstrate ability to secure financing or investment for the full investment range. Lenders typically evaluate senior care franchises favorably due to recurring revenue streams and growing market demand.

### Are financing options or third-party funding programs available for Elder-Well franchisees?

Many franchisees explore SBA loans, home equity lines of credit, or personal investment to fund their franchise. The franchisor can recommend preferred lenders familiar with senior care franchise financing and may offer guidance on structuring your funding strategy.

### What initial training does Elder-Well provide to new franchise owners?

The system provides 30 hours of comprehensive classroom training covering operations, client care standards, regulatory compliance, marketing, and technology systems. Training typically occurs at the franchisor's facility or through hybrid delivery, preparing you to launch and manage your territory effectively.
